TCPC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2013 in Review

99 of the 3,445 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in BlackRock TCP Capital (TCPC) for Q4 2013, worth a combined $273M — up 34% from $204M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 15 funds opened new TCPC positions and 10 closed out — a net gain of 5 holders — while 46 added to existing stakes and 25 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Vaughan Nelson Investment Management, adding an estimated $14.2M. The largest seller was Wells Fargo, cutting an estimated $4.91M.
